About

Marcello Chiaberge is a leading researcher at the intersection of precision agriculture, autonomous robotics, and deep learning. His work primarily focuses on developing intelligent navigation systems for agricultural environments, particularly vineyards, where he has pioneered cost-effective solutions that replace expensive sensors with advanced computer vision and deep reinforcement learning techniques. With over 73 citations for his work on RGB-D camera-based local motion planners and 45 citations for position-agnostic navigation using deep reinforcement learning, Chiaberge's contributions are shaping the future of smart farming. He is also the creator of Marvin, an innovative omni-directional robotic assistant for domestic environments, and has advanced edge computing through generative adversarial super-resolution models. His comprehensive review on human following and guidance by autonomous mobile robots demonstrates his broader impact on human-robot interaction. Chiaberge's work on cloud robotics architectures for smart city emergency management and the PIC4rl-gym framework for modular autonomous navigation research further cements his reputation as a versatile innovator, bridging the gap between theoretical deep learning and practical robotic applications.
